For a QB, Geno was not drafted high.

In this NFL climate, a QB will always get drafted in the 1st round if a team believes they will amount to anything above average. If they reach the 2nd round, they become value aka "why not?" draft picks

This is exactly why I like what the Jets did. I dont think they were dead set on drafting Geno, but he fell to them. Drafting Geno doesnt prevent them from taking another one next year.
Exactly. San Diego drafted Drew Brees in the 2nd and still ended up taking Phillip Rivers. Carolina drafted Jimmy Clausen in the 2nd and still ended up taking Cam Newton.

If a QB is garbage/not the answer, there's no shame in admitting it and immediately searching for his replacement.
